From: Andres Freund Date: Wed, 9 Jul 2025 22:38:05 +0000 (-0400) Subject: Use pg_assume() to avoid compiler warning below exec_set_found() X-Git-Url: http://git.ipfire.org/cgi-bin/gitweb.cgi?a=commitdiff_plain;h=48a23f6eae710d2c5c29f38e66d76e7919117e4d;p=thirdparty%2Fpostgresql.git Use pg_assume() to avoid compiler warning below exec_set_found() The warning, visible when building with -O3 and a recent-ish gcc, is due to gcc not realizing that found is a byvalue type and therefore will never be interpreted as a varlena type.
